Transaction 3944511180f84eca3e6df97d61bf44dc4295592b5258a706ba85b951048a6043
1 Input
1 Output
-
3944511180f84eca3e6df97d61bf44dc4295592b5258a706ba85b951048a6043:0
- value
- 4308450
- script pubkey
- OP_0 OP_PUSHBYTES_20 690bdb5335a32dcbfb5d9370e33df2a86f5d3dcb
- address
- bc1qdy9ak5e45vkuh76ajdcwx00j4ph460wt9tun02